在当今信息化迅速发展的时代,网络安全问题日益凸显。作为一种网络协议,vmess结合了ws(WebSocket)技术,广泛应用于科学上网、翻墙等需求。那么,vmess+ws安全吗?在这篇文章中,我们将深入探讨这个问题。
什么是vmess和ws?
vmess协议
vmess是一种加密的网络协议,主要用于在网络环境中传输数据,尤其是在防火墙、网络审查环境中。它的主要特点包括:
- 数据加密:采用加密算法保障数据的机密性。
- 身份验证:使用UUID作为身份标识,有效防止伪装攻击。
- 支持多种传输方式:可以结合多种传输协议使用,如TCP、KCP、WebSocket等。
WebSocket(ws)
WebSocket是一种双向通信协议,允许客户端与服务器之间建立持久的连接,适合于实时应用。其优势在于:
- 低延迟:在保持连接后,数据传输延迟极低。
- 支持跨域:允许不同源的域名间进行通信,提升灵活性。
vmess+ws的工作原理
vmess+ws结合了两种技术的优势,通过WebSocket的长连接功能,可以有效绕过网络审查和阻断。具体过程如下:
- 客户端发起与服务器的WebSocket连接。
- 数据在传输过程中通过vmess协议进行加密处理。
- 一旦连接建立,数据将通过WebSocket进行双向传输,确保实时性与稳定性。
vmess+ws的安全性分析
优势
- 高安全性:使用vmess协议进行数据加密,有效保障数据的隐私和安全。
- 抗审查性强:结合WebSocket后,能够较好地绕过网络审查。
- 灵活性:可以配置多种传输方式,满足不同需求。
潜在风险
虽然vmess+ws有诸多优势,但在使用过程中也存在一些潜在风险:
- 被识别的风险:如果流量特征明显,可能被深度包检测(DPI)识别。
- DNS泄露:在使用不当的情况下,可能导致DNS信息泄露。
- 不安全的服务器:选择不可靠的VPN或代理服务提供商可能导致数据泄露。
如何提高vmess+ws的安全性
要有效提升vmess+ws的安全性,可以采取以下措施:
- 使用安全的服务器:选择信誉良好的服务提供商,确保其提供安全性高的服务。
- 定期更换配置:定期更换UUID和其他配置,降低被识别的风险。
- 使用防DNS泄露工具:配置防止DNS泄露的工具,如使用DoH(DNS over HTTPS)或VPN。
- 定期更新客户端:保持软件的最新状态,及时修补已知漏洞。
FAQ(常见问题解答)
vmess和ws有什么区别?
vmess是一种网络传输协议,而*WebSocket(ws)*是一种用于建立实时双向通信的协议。前者注重数据的加密和传输安全,后者则强调连接的实时性。
vmess+ws如何防止被识别?
- 定期更换UUID和相关配置。
- 尽量避免使用明显的流量特征(如特定的端口或头部信息)。
- 考虑使用混淆技术,减少流量被识别的可能性。
使用vmess+ws会影响网速吗?
vmess+ws的性能通常受到多个因素影响,包括网络状况、服务器负载等。合理配置和选择合适的服务器可最大化利用网络速度。
如何选择合适的vmess+ws服务器?
- 选择拥有良好口碑和用户评价的服务提供商。
- 注意服务器的地理位置,通常选择靠近用户的服务器会获得更好的速度。
- 查看服务器的负载情况,避免高负载的服务器影响使用体验。
总结
通过上述分析,我们可以看出,vmess+ws在保护数据安全和隐私方面有着良好的表现,但用户在使用时仍需注意潜在的风险和安全隐患。采取适当的安全措施,可以有效提升使用体验,保障网络安全。
正文完